This is where the comes into play. A test point is a specific set of metal contacts on the phone's main circuit board (PCB) that, when shorted together (often using tweezers), forces the processor to boot directly into Emergency Download mode. Finding and using these points is the most reliable way to enter EDL mode on a hard-bricked device, and doing it yourself is the "free" part of the equation, circumventing the need for paid third-party services.
